Партнерка на США и Канаду по недвижимости, выплаты в крипто
- 30% recurring commission
- Выплаты в USDT
- Вывод каждую неделю
- Комиссия до 5 лет за каждого referral
Данный контейнер содержит описания координат пространства, занимаемого зоной.
Задаётся опреляется следующим образом:
- cтрока в формате '[x, y, ширина, высота]' определяет прямоугольную активную зону объекта строка в формате '{(x1, y1), (x2, y2), … (xn, yn)}' определяет многоугольную активную зону разные зоны можно комбинировать путем перечисления через пробел, например "{(x1, y1),…(xn, yn)} [x, y, width, height] {(x1,y1), … (xm, ym)}".
Общая структура элемента «area».
<area
<!-- прямоугольник [x, y, w, h] -->
<!-- многоугольник {(x, y),(x, y), ...} -->
<!-- комбинированный вариант определения зоны
{(x1, y1),…(xn, yn)} [x, y, width, height] {(x1,y1), … (xm, ym)}"-->
</area>
Пример
<zone id="1" enabled="true">
<param depth="-5"/>
<area>[110,895,100,100]</area>
<actions>
<action event="onPress">showObject:01</action>
</actions>
</zone>
<zone id="2" enabled="true">
<param depth="-5"/>
<area>{(0,59),(83,59),(207,0),(554,107),(85,281)}</area>
<actions>
<action event="onPress">showObject:02</action>
</actions>
</zone>
В данном примере приведены две зоны. Первая (с id="1") задана в виде прямоугольника. Вторая в виде многоугольника из 5ти точек.
7.4.3 Элемент <zone><mask >
Элемент определяет изображение, которое будет являться частью активной зоны (с учётом прозрачности частей изображения). Активными являются все части данного изображения, прозрачность которых не превышает 10% (0.1).
Атрибуты
x | Необязательный атрибут. Координата по горизонтальной оси в пикселях относительно родительского контейнера. Значение по умолчанию: 0. |
y | Необязательный атрибут. Координата по вертикальной оси в пикселях относительно родительского контейнера. Значение по умолчанию: 0. |
depth | Необязательный атрибут. Глубина объекта на экране относительно родительского объекта. Значение по умолчанию: 0. |
src | Обязательный атрибут Путь к файлу изображения, которое является маской. |
Пример:
Для приведённого ниже изображения, чувствительным к событиям мыши будет только часть, выделенная темным цветом (полностью непрозрачная), в то время как светлая часть не будет воспринимать события мыши.

Задание зоны с помощью маски. Маской выступает в данном случае изображение "01.png"
<zone id="1" visible="true">
<mask src="/DATA/components/Research_groups/01.png" depth="-11"/>
<param depth="-5"/>
<actions>
<action event="onPress">showObject:p1</action>
</actions>
</zone>
7.4.4 Элемент <effect>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.4.5 Элемент <rollovermenu>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.4.6 Элемент <control>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.4.7 Элемент <title>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.4.8 Элемент <hint>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.4.9 Элемент <attach>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.5 Объект «Текст»
Объект позволяет выводить текст на экран. Для каждого объекта возможно определить:
· положение на экране
· прозрачность объекта
· активную зону объекта
· группу элементов управления
· подпись
· всплывающую подсказку
· назначить реакцию на события
Общая структура
<text
id="" visible="">
<param.../>
<scroller.../>
<value.../>
<title.../>
<hint.../>
<control.../>
<effect.../>
<attach.../>
<actions.../>
</text>
7.5.1 Атрибуты:
id | Необязательный атрибут. Задаёт идентификатор объекта. Необходим, если нужно выполнять некоторые действия в отношении данного объекта, а также при использовании автоматического присоединения других объектов к данному. |
visible | Необязательный атрибут. Задаёт видимость объекта на экране. Значение по умолчанию: false (объект не виден на экране). В дальнейшем видимость объекта может быть изменена с помощью действий (actions): showObject, hideObject и т. д. |
7.5.2 Элемент <param>
Обязательный элемент
Пример
<text visible="true">
<param x="100" y="100" width="500" height="300"
depth="-10"
src="/DATA/components/zadanie_2/zadan_2.html"
scroll="false"
style="Tahoma_19_5c5b01"
bgcolor="#000000"
/>
...
</text>
Атрибуты
Описания общих атрибутов контейнера <param> приведены в разделе «Описание общих элементов информационных объектов». В данной части руководства приведены описания атрибутов, предназначенных исключительно для текстовых файлов.
height | Необязательный атрибут. Если значение данного атрибута неопределенно, то высота объекта соответствует высоте шрифта текстовой строки. |
scroll | Необязательный атрибут. Прокрутка текста, выходящего за рамки текстового поля. Значение по умолчанию: false. Возможные значения:
|
style | Необязательный атрибут. Даный атрибут позволяет назначать текстовому объекту стиль. |
bgColor | Цвет фона (в случае если type="border") Значение по умолчанию: #FFFFFF (черный). Возможные значения: #000000-#FFFFFF или # - #FFFFFFFF Примечание: Значение цвета может задаваться в одном из двух видов: #RRGGBB – в шестнадцатеричной системе в формате RGB, прозрачность при этом не учитывается #AARRGGBB – в шестнадцатеричном формате ARGB, при этом существует возможность указать полупрозрачный цвет фона |
7.5.3 Элемент <scroller>
Необязательный элемент. Определяет настройки скроллинга. Если данный элемент отсутствует, то используются общие настройки, описанные в разделе «Настройка общих стилей».
Пример
<text visible="true">
<scroller indent="[true|false]"
xOffset ="{число}"
yOffset ="{число}"
height="[число%|-число|число]"
depth="{число}"
/>
...
</text>
Атрибуты
Настройки скроллинга.
indent | Необязательный атрибут. Определяет находится скроллинг внутри определенного размера текстового поля или снаружи. Значение по умолчанию: true. Возможные значения:
|
xOffset | Необязательный атрибут. Указывает смещение относительно правой стороны текстового поля. |
yOffset | Необязательный атрибут. Указывает смещение относительно верхней стороны текстового поля. |
height | Необязательный атрибут. Определяет высоту скроллинга. Значение по умолчанию: Используются общие настройки, описанные в разделе «Настройка общих стилей». Возможные значения:
|
depth | Необязательный атрибут. Определяет глубину размещения объекта. |
7.5.4 Элемент <value>
Необязательный элемент
Задаёт основные характеристики вывода объекта на экран.
Общая структура
<value>
Строка
</value>
Содержимое
Строка текста. Может содержать некоторые элементы HTML – разметки. Если в строке необходимо использовать специальные символы (угловые кавычки и проч.), то необходимо содержимое элемента заключать в элемент <!CDATA>:
<value>
<![CDATA["..."]]>
</value>
Пример
<text visible="true">
<param x="100" y="100" width="500" height="300"
depth="-10"/>
<value><![CDATA[«...»]]></value>
</text>
7.5.5 Элемент <effects>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.5.6 Элемент <effect>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
Пример 1 Пример использования эффектов для элемента «Текст».
<text id="01" visible="true">
<param src="/DATA/components/01.htm" x="324" y="255" width="200"
height="150" depth="100"/>
<effects>
<effect id="effect_1" event="onShow">
fade:0.05,0,1
</effect>
</effects>
</text>
7.5.7 Элемент <control>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.5.8 Элемент <title>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.5.9 Элемент <hint>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.5.10 Элемент <attach>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.5.11 События, порождаемые объектом «Текст»
Событие | Описание | Параметры |
onShow | возникает в момент появления текста | - |
onHide | возникает в момент скрытия текста | - |
onRollOver | возникает при наезде на текст курсором мыши | - |
onRollOut | возникает при съезде курсора мыши с текста | - |
onPress | возникает при нажатии мышью на текст | - |
onRelease | возникает при отпускании кнопки мыши над текстом | - |
onStartEffect | возникает при старте некоторого назначенного эффекта (если эффекты назначены) | id эффекта |
onCompleteEffect | возникает при завершении некоторого визуального эффекта (если эффекты назначены) | id эффекта |
7.5.12 Действия, применимые к объекту «Текст»
showObject | Показать объект с заданным id | id объекта |
hideObject | спрятать объект данным id | id объекта |
showObjectOnly | Показать объект(ы) с заданным id, при этом спрятать объекты с другими id, расположенные на одном уровне (в общем контейнере), например, в общей группе. | id объекта |
hideAllObjects | спрятать все объекты | id объекта |
enableObject | сделать объект активным | id объекта |
saveObject | Сохранить объект (при этом на экране отображается окно диалога сохранения файла) | id объекта |
copyObject | скопировать объект в буфер | id объекта |
setPosition | Изменить положение объекта на экране | id_объекта, x,y, width, height[,depth] |
7.5.13 Задание гиперссылок в текстовых объектах
Наряду со стандартными ссылками, поддерживаемыми HTML, плеер ОМС реализует несколько своих типов гиперссылок:
- Всплывающий комментарий (текст или картинка) Переход в Интернет
Максимальная ширина текстовой всплывающей подсказки, цвет фоновой заливки под текстом и стиль шрифта задаются в шаблоне. Высота текстового поля вычисляется автоматически.
Для загрузки другого модуля необходимо задать ссылку следующего вида
<A href="oms-module://идентификатор модуля">тело гиперссылки</A>
Для задания текстового всплывающего комментария необходимо задать ссылку следующего вида
<A href="eHint://type=text&src=путь к файлу">тело ссылки</A>
или
<A href="eHint://type=text&value=текст всплывающего комментария">тело ссылки</A>
Для задания всплывающего комментария в виде картинки необходимо задать ссылку следующего вида
<A href="eHint://type=image&src=путь к файлу[&scale=0.2]">тело ссылки</A>,
где scale – коэффициент масштабирования.
Для перехода по гиперссылкам в интернет необходимо задать ссылку следующего вида <A href="http://www. имя ресурса. ru">тело ссылки</A>, при этом будет запущено на выполнение стандартное приложение для работы с интернетом. Таким же образом будут обрабатываться следующие протоколы: https, ftp, mailto
Пример:
Ссылка
<A href="mailto:*****@***ru">тело ссылки</A>
Фрагмент html-файла со ссылкой
...
<p>В лето 6Изгнали <a href="eHint://type=text&value=ВАРЯГИ - в русских источниках - скандинавы, полулегендарные князья (Рюрик, Синеус, Трувор и др.), наемные дружинники русских князей 9-11 веков">варягов</a> за море и не дали им дани, и начали сами собой владеть. И не было среди них правды, и встал род на род, и были между ними усобицы, и начали воевать сами с собой...
<br><br>
При этом на экране отобразится всплывающая подсказка примерно следующего вида:

7.6 Объект «Аудио» (audio)
Объект позволяет воспроизводить звуковые файлы wav (mp3, упакованный в wav контейнер), mp3, ogg. Для каждого объекта возможно определить:
· группу элементов управления
· подпись
· назначить реакцию на события
Элемент имеет следующую общую структуру
<audio
id="" visible="">
<param.../>
<title.../>
<control.../>
<actions.../>
</audio>
7.6.1 Атрибуты:
id | Необязательный атрибут. Задаёт идентификатор объекта. Необходим, если нужно выполнять некоторые действия в отношении данного объекта. |
visible | Необязательный атрибут. Задаёт видимость некоторых элементов объекта на экране (control, title…). Значение по умолчанию: false (объект не виден на экране). В дальнейшем видимость объекта может быть изменена с помощью действий (actions): showObject, hideObject и т. д. |
playing | Необязательный атрибут. Начало проигрывания при показе объекта. Значение по умолчанию: false (объект не начинает проигрываться автоматически). |
7.6.2 Элемент <param>
Обязательный элемент
Задаёт основные характеристики вывода объекта на экран.
Общая структура
<param
src="{Путь к файлу}"
loop="[false|true]"
/>
Атрибуты
src | Обязательный атрибут. Задаёт путь к звуковому файлу (см. Задание путей к объектам). |
loop | Необязательный атрибут. Зацикленность воспроизведения аудио. Значение по умолчанию: false |
Пример
<audio id="01" visible="true">
<param src="/data/music_01.mp3" loop="true"/>
</audio>
7.6.3 Элемент <control>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.6.4 Элемент <title>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.6.5 События, порождаемые объектом «Аудио»
См. соответствующе разделы данного руководства:
· События (event), порождаемые объектами сцены.
· События(event), инициализируемые протяженными во времени объектами.
7.6.6 Действия, применимые к объекту «Аудио»
showObject | Показать объект с заданным id | id объекта |
hideObject | спрятать объект данным id | id объекта |
showObjectOnly | Показать объект(ы) с заданным id, при этом спрятать объекты с другими id, расположенные на одном уровне (в общем контейнере), например, в общей группе. | id объекта |
hideAllObjects | Спрятать все объекты. | id объекта |
enableObject | Сделать объект активным. | id объекта |
saveObject | Сохранить объект (при этом на экране отображается окно диалога сохранения файла) | id объекта |
7.7 Объект «Видео» (video)
Объект позволяет воспроизводить видеофрагменты. Для каждого объекта можно определить:
· положение на экране;
· прозрачность объекта;
· активную зону объекта;
· группу элементов управления;
· подпись;
· всплывающее меню;
· всплывающую подсказку;
Элемент имеет следующую общую структуру
<video id="{Строка}"
visible="[true|false]"
playing="[true|false]">
<param
src="{Путь к файлу}"
x="{число}"
y="{число}"
width="{число}"
height="{число}"
depth="{число}"
/>
</video>
7.7.1 Атрибуты
id | Необязательный атрибут. Задаёт идентификатор объекта. Необходим, если нужно выполнять некоторые действия в отношении данного объекта, а также при использовании автоматического присоединения других объектов к данному. |
visible | Необязательный атрибут. Задаёт видимость объекта на экране. Значение по умолчанию: false (объект не виден на экране). В дальнейшем видимость объекта может быть изменена с помощью действий (actions): showObject, hideObject и т. д. |
playing | Необязательный атрибут. Начальное поведение объекта при показе. Значение по умолчанию: false (объект не начинает проигрываться автоматически). |
7.7.2 Элемент <param>
Обязательный элемент
Задаёт основные характеристики вывода объекта на экран.
Общая структура
<param
src=""
loop="false"
x="0"
y="0"
width="0"
height="0"
depth="0"
opacity="1"
hitArea="bounds"
/>
Атрибуты
src | Обязательный атрибут. Задаёт путь к видеофайлу (см. Задание путей к объектам). |
loop | Необязательный атрибут. Зацикленность воспроизведения аудио. |
Остальные свойства типичны для всех видимых объектов и описаны в соответствующем разделе данного руководчства.
Пример 1 | Пример использования элемента «Видео». |
<video id="01" visible="true"> <param src="/DATA/components/01.mpg" x="324" y="255" width="320" height="240" depth="100"/> </video> |
7.7.3 Элемент <effects>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.7.4 Элемент <effects><effect>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
Пример 1 Пример использования эффектов для элемента «Видео».
<video id="01" visible="true">
<param src="/DATA/components/01.mpg" x="100" y="100" width="320"
height="240"/>
<effects>
<effect id="effect_1" event="onShow">
move:15,{(-100,100),(100,100)}
</effect>
</effects>
</video>
7.7.5 Элемент <rollovermenu>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.7.6 Элемент <control>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.7.7 Элемент <title>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.7.8 Элемент <hint>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.7.9 Элемент <attach>
Необязательный элемент
См. соответствующий подраздел раздела «Описание общих элементов информационных объектов» данного руководства.
7.7.10 События, порождаемые объектом «Видео»
См. соответствующе разделы данного руководства:
· События (event), порождаемые объектами сцены.
· События(event), инициализируемые протяженными во времени объектами.
|
Из за большого объема этот материал размещен на нескольких страницах: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 |


